About Dr. Refai

Shariq Refai, MD, MBA, is a board-certified psychiatrist and the medical editor of PsychiatryRx. He has worked in psychiatry for more than fifteen years, with a particular focus on anxiety, overthinking, panic, and the day-to-day reality of living with these conditions.

He is the founder of shrinkMD, an independent multistate telepsychiatry practice, and the creator of the Unstuck app, a self-guided mental wellness tool. He is also the author of three books on anxiety and overthinking, and he runs shrinkMD Publishing, the imprint that publishes those books and this site.

Training and credentials

Dr. Refai holds dual board certification in psychiatry and in sports and performance psychiatry. He earned his medical degree at St. George's University School of Medicine, and completed residency training at the University of Hawaii and at John Peter Smith Hospital. He holds an MBA from Duke University, along with certificates in Electroconvulsive Therapy and in Obesity Medicine from Columbia University.

Before medical school, while studying at the University of North Florida, he worked nights as a psychiatric technician. He has said that this period shaped much of how he thinks about mental health and access to care, and the lesson he took from it: that mental illness does not discriminate by income, profession, or background.

His work and focus

Dr. Refai's clinical and writing work centers on anxiety, overthinking, panic, and emotional awareness, and on making psychiatric care clearer and less stigmatized. He built shrinkMD after concluding that many digital psychiatry models were not delivering the continuity, follow-up, and clinical responsibility he would want for his own family. Across his clinical work, his books, and his public writing, the aim is the same: to translate psychiatric concepts into plain, accurate language that respects the reader.
